012 [Situation] About 7/8 mile W.S.W. [West South West] of Loanhead [Descriptive Remarks] A farm house with offices on the estate of Col. [Colonel] Gibson.

012 [Situation] About 1/4 miles W.S.W. [West South West] of Loanhead [Descriptive Remarks] An Inn near Bilston Toll Bar, the property of the Innkeeper Mr. Frazer.

012 [Situation] About 1/4 miles W.S.W. [West South West] of Loanhead [Descriptive Remarks] A toll bar, with gate-keeper's house at a junction of Roads near Bilston Inn.

012 [Situation] N.E. [North East] side of Loanhead [Descriptive Remarks] An extensive colliery in the village of Loanhead now in process of work & yielding a fair quantity of Coal. Sir G. Clerk is the proprietor
